Instead, you should let the still image output do the compression for you, since its compression is hardware-accelerated. If you want to add the asset to a composition AVMutableCompositionyou typically need precise random access. SDKs iOS 2. Thanks Chris, this is awesome! Sign up or log in Sign up using Google. Playing an Item To start playback, you send a play message to the player. This can present a challenge, since, if you change them one at a time, a new setting may be incompatible with an existing setting. An audio player that provides playback of audio data from a file or memory. Thank you, Mohamed. When it is ready to play, the player item creates the AVAsset and AVAssetTrack instances, which you can use to inspect the contents of the live stream.
Video: Addperiodictimeobserverforinterval avaudioplayer multiple sounds How To Create AudioPlayer With Swift 4 & Xcode 9 ? ( Part 1)
The reason the audio stops is because you only have one AVAudioPlayer set up, so when you ask the class to play another sound you are currently replacing. › documentation › avaudioplayer. Play multiple sounds simultaneously, one sound per audio player, with precise The AVAudioPlayer class lets you play sound in any audio format available in.
TBD First version of a document that describes a low-level framework you use to play, inspect, create, edit, capture, and transcode media assets.
In a typical simple case, one track represents the audio component, and another represents the video component; in a complex composition, however, there may be multiple overlapping tracks of audio and video.
[iOS] AVPlayer plays audio and video Programmer Sought
Using an approximate duration is typically a cheaper operation and sufficient for playback. Some states do not allow the exclusion or limitation of implied warranties or liability for incidental or consequential damages, so the above limitation or exclusion may not apply to you.
Hi Chris, Thank you for your awesome site! You must ensure that your implementation of captureOutput:didOutputSampleBuffer:fromConnection: is able to process a sample buffer within the amount of time allotted to a frame.
AVAudioPlayer AVFoundation Apple Developer Documentation
You can find a short clip on the net or download the source code for this demo to use the sample MP3 that I used.
[Slow start for AVAudioPlayer the first time a sound is played. (d) use addPeriodicTimeObserverForInterval to check if you ran off a video clip and react. If you're syncing across multiple devices (which your application might suggest) just.
I want to be able to play back multiple video streams at once. .
ios Get AVAudioPlayer to play multiple sounds at a time Stack Overflow
[player addPeriodicTimeObserverForInterval:CMTimeMake(, ) queue:dispatch_get_main_queue() usingBlock:^(CMTime time) A value of one will result in playing the sound twice, and so on. This property is already defined inside AVAudioPlayer.
Audio levels are not key-value observable, so you must poll for updated levels as often as you want to update your user interface for example, 10 times a second.
Video: Addperiodictimeobserverforinterval avaudioplayer multiple sounds Play Audio in Your App in 4 Steps Using AVAudioPlayer (Swift)
The UID of the current audio player. Unlike a capture output, a video preview layer retains the session with which it is associated. The drum should be playing well after each tap of the button.
Makalele Makalele 5, 3 3 gold badges 38 38 silver badges 62 62 bronze badges. In addition, you can use an instance of preview layer to show the user what a camera is recording. Understanding its structure will help you to understand how the framework works.